Breakfast Burrito
-whole wheat tortilla
-egg beaters
-2 slices turkey bacon
-reduced fat cheese
-fat-free salsa
-sour cream

This came out to about 8 points + and was pretty tasty!

WW Friendly Spaghetti
-1/2 box whole grain spaghetti
-4 servings Boca meatless ground crumbles
-1 jar "veggie smart" Prego pasta sauce
-1 onion
-2 cloves garlic
-grated parmesan cheese

This came out to about 10 points + per serving. I thought it tasted pretty good! I couldn't tell the difference between the Boca crumbles and ground beef. I didn't miss the ground beef at all, actually!

9 month check up

We took Sophie for her 9 month check up this week. She was so good at the doctor's office! In fact, she cried when the doctor left the room. I think she really likes him! All is still going well. She's growing like she should and there were no concerns at all. The doctor said she can eat anything now except for fish that is high in mercury, raw honey, and nuts. Otherwise, she is free to go! He also said that we need to start practicing more with a sippy cup because she'll stop using a bottle in just 3 short months. It is really unbelievable that my baby has grown so quickly!



She now weighs 20lbs, 4 oz (75th percentile) and is 28 and 3/4 inches long (90th percentile). Her head circumference is 44 1/2 cm (60th percentile). She did have to get a finger prick to be sure that she's not anemic and the last in the series of Hepatitis B shots. She was not happy when we left. Here she is once we got home.
